What is Alakh AI?

Alakh AI is more than just another tutoring tool, it is designed as a study companion for students that can assist in both academic and non-academic aspects. This tool will offer personalized study plans, and motivational support, and even assist them in solving academic questions and answers.
One of the good features of Alakh AI is its generative capabilities. It is trained on PhysicsWallah’s study materials and style, which makes this AI tool more adaptive and personalized.
Alakh AI covers a global audience by offering courses in multiple languages. It not only enhances the company’s accessibility but also reduces the operational costs of the company.

Physics Wallah
It was founded in 2016 by Alakh Pandey as a YouTube channel for students who are preparing for competitive exams. Later it became full full-fledged edtech startup by offering a wide range of courses. In the last few years, this company has been on an expansion spree.
Prateek Maheshwari joined as co-founder of PhysicsWallah in 2020. Last month, the co-founder Prateek Maheswari told Inc42 that it expects more than INR 2000 Cr in revenue in the upcoming financial year 2023-2024. She also told the company had already achieved INR 2000Cr revenue in January 2024.
Maheswari did not reveal the actual profit of PhysicsWallah, she said PW’s adjusted EBITDA will be around 80 Cr in FY24, from INR 119.6 Cr in FY23. PhysicsWallah entered a unicorn club by acquiring a $100 Million fund from Westbridge and GSV Ventures. Since then it has been expanding its offerings by making offline space for students and acquiring multiple startups and companies.
It also offers programs for postgraduates. It also runs an upskilling platform named PW Upskills for students. Earlier this month, PW ventured into offline education by offering classes for primary school students by its name PW Gurukulam School.
It also announced an INR 100 Cr investment for strengthening its UPSC course offering Platform UPSC vertical and INR 120 Cr for PW Skills.

AI educational suites offered by PhysicsWallah
AI Guru (Personalised Tutor) – It is a 24/7 personal AI tutor and assistant. It is designed to make its student’s learning experience unique and personal. It will help students in clearing doubts in text, image, and speech modes.
NCERT Pitara – By leveraging the power of GenAI, it generates questions from various NCERT books. It offers questions in various formats like single-choice questions, multiple-choice questions, and fill-in-the-blanks.
Sahayak – It offers a personalized experience for students by providing adaptive practices, revision, and backlog clearance. It also offers custom content recommendations for students like videos and practices questions.
Community Learning – This platform offers collaborative learning with batch-specific learning groups for its students. There is one live practice session named ‘Battleground’, by which students can practice questions and answers with their favorite teachers and batchmates.
Increased Accessibility with Low Data mode – PhysicsWallah’s latest feature consumes as much as 80-90% less data. By this students can watch a large number of videos in their existing data package.
Focused Learning with ‘LearnOS Tapasya Mode’ – It is an Android mobile launcher designed to minimize students’ online distractions. Its TapasyaMode can block distracting apps for the chosen duration and enables focused study sessions by keeping away from distracting apps.
